
:root{color-scheme:dark;--bg:#090b10;--panel:#111620;--panel2:#151b27;--text:#eef3ff;--muted:#9ca8ba;--line:#263142;--accent:#78f3c6;--accent2:#8ab4ff;--warn:#ffd38a}*{box-sizing:border-box}body{margin:0;background:radial-gradient(circle at 20% 0%,#152438 0,#090b10 38%,#07080b 100%);color:var(--text);font:17px/1.75 -apple-system,BlinkMacSystemFont,"Segoe UI",sans-serif}.site-header{display:flex;align-items:center;justify-content:space-between;padding:24px clamp(20px,5vw,72px);border-bottom:1px solid var(--line);background:rgba(9,11,16,.8);backdrop-filter:blur(18px);position:sticky;top:0;z-index:5}.brand{font-weight:800;color:var(--text);text-decoration:none;letter-spacing:.02em}.tagline{color:var(--muted);font-size:14px}.article-shell{max-width:1040px;margin:0 auto;padding:56px 20px 88px}.article{max-width:820px;margin:0 auto}.eyebrow{color:var(--accent);text-transform:uppercase;letter-spacing:.12em;font-size:13px;font-weight:700}.article h1{font-size:clamp(36px,6vw,68px);line-height:1.04;margin:14px 0 18px;letter-spacing:-.055em}.subtitle{font-size:clamp(19px,2.4vw,25px);line-height:1.55;color:#c9d5e8;margin-bottom:34px}.hero{margin:34px 0 46px;padding:12px;border:1px solid var(--line);border-radius:24px;background:linear-gradient(180deg,#131a25,#0d1118);box-shadow:0 24px 90px rgba(0,0,0,.35)}.hero img{display:block;width:100%;border-radius:16px}.hero figcaption{font-size:13px;color:var(--muted);padding:12px 6px 2px}.hero a,.article a{color:var(--accent2)}section{margin:46px 0}.article h2{font-size:29px;line-height:1.25;margin:0 0 16px;letter-spacing:-.03em}.article h3{margin:0 0 8px;color:var(--accent)}p{margin:14px 0;color:#dce5f5}strong{color:#fff}.grid.two{display:grid;grid-template-columns:repeat(2,minmax(0,1fr));gap:16px;margin:22px 0}.card{padding:22px;border:1px solid var(--line);border-radius:20px;background:linear-gradient(180deg,var(--panel2),var(--panel))}.principles{padding-left:22px}.principles li{margin:22px 0;padding-left:8px}.principles strong{font-size:20px}.checklist{list-style:none;padding:0;margin:20px 0}.checklist li{padding:14px 16px;margin:10px 0;border:1px solid var(--line);border-radius:14px;background:rgba(120,243,198,.06)}.checklist li:before{content:'✓';color:var(--accent);font-weight:800;margin-right:10px}.loop{display:flex;gap:12px;align-items:center;justify-content:center;flex-wrap:wrap;margin:28px 0;padding:22px;border-radius:22px;border:1px solid var(--line);background:rgba(138,180,255,.08)}.loop span{padding:10px 16px;border-radius:999px;background:#172033;color:#fff;font-weight:800}.loop b{color:var(--accent)}code{background:#1a2331;color:var(--warn);padding:.12em .35em;border-radius:6px}.article-footer{margin-top:64px;padding-top:24px;border-top:1px solid var(--line);font-size:14px;color:var(--muted)}.home{max-width:960px;margin:0 auto;padding:64px 20px}.home h1{font-size:clamp(42px,7vw,84px);letter-spacing:-.06em;line-height:1}.post-card{display:grid;grid-template-columns:220px 1fr;gap:22px;margin-top:32px;padding:18px;border:1px solid var(--line);border-radius:24px;background:linear-gradient(180deg,#121925,#0e131b);text-decoration:none;color:var(--text)}.post-card img{width:100%;border-radius:16px;aspect-ratio:16/9;object-fit:cover}.post-card p{color:var(--muted)}@media(max-width:720px){.grid.two,.post-card{grid-template-columns:1fr}.site-header{align-items:flex-start;gap:8px;flex-direction:column}.article-shell{padding-top:32px}}
